Default Affix wheel well trim with cable ties

(2021 CR-V Hybrid Touring)
Passing a suggestion along that might prove handy for someone.

We had a low speed impact with a tree that displaced but didn't really damage the front bumper other than some small breaks in the chrome.. Fortunately, everything was easy enough to push back in place, except the black plastic trim around the wheel well. Its attachment point toward the front of the car had sheared. But no obvious reason to have the dealer repair/replace anything.

I tried duct tape to keep the trim in place as a temporary measure, but that failed miserably. Although the plastic piece initially was almost aligned in place, the wind from driving pulled it away from the car like a broken wing on a bird.

The "right" way would have been to buy new trim and figure out how to install it. Maybe that would have been easy.

I was about to start figuring that out when I realized a solution that seems to be working well for the past few weeks. I bought a set of black 8" cable ties (UV resistant, "Steel Grip" from Ace Hardware) to fit through the trim (new hole) and through some existing holes in the wheel well, near the original attachment point. I took a small drill and cut a slot (two adjacent holes) in the trim just big enough to get the cable tie through and fed the end of the it through the slot. Using some small needle nose pliers I grabbed the end of the cable tie and pulled it through the small holes in the wheel well. When I pulled it tight, I positioned the head of the cable tie so it was over the hole in the wheel well.

Because the trim had bent enough from the wind, I found a second place where I could secure the trim in the same way. The trim fits tightly and the ties match the black trim perfectly. You wouldn't notice either of the cable ties without looking closely.
